Unmasking Narcissistic Control: How to Spot and Combat Their Manipulative Strategies
Are you feeling that someone in your life might be a narcissist? It's essential to recognize the red flags of narcissistic manipulation, as these individuals often use subtle and insidious tactics to manipulate others. By learning about their common patterns, you can successfully defend yourself against their influence.
- Common narcissistic manipulation methods include guilt-tripping, gaslighting, and love bombing.
- Narcissists often display a deficiency in empathy and view others as objects to be used for their own gain.
- Establishing healthy boundaries is essential when dealing with a narcissist.
It's essential to remember that you deserve to be treated with respect. By being aware about narcissistic manipulation, you can defend your emotional well-being and build stronger, healthier relationships.
Breaking Free from the Chains of Narcissistic Abuse: Reclaiming Your Power
Emerging from narcissistic abuse can feel like navigating a labyrinth. You has been wounded, leaving you feeling lost and devastated. It's essential to understand that recovery is possible. Start with acknowledging the abuse and its impact on your life. This can be a difficult process, but it's crucial for moving forward.
Remember, you are not alone. There are resources available to help you navigate this complex path. Seek support from a therapist. Allow yourself to feel your emotions, process them, and gradually begin to mend your sense of self.
Nurture your inner strength. Rekindle your passions and interests. Celebrate your successes. With time, patience, and read more unwavering self-belief, you can break free from the chains of narcissistic abuse and reclaim your power.
